flask-migrate数据迁移
生活随笔
收集整理的這篇文章主要介紹了
flask-migrate数据迁移
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
flask-migrate
作用:做數據庫遷移
依賴:
flask-script?
flask-sqlalchemy
使用
項目結構
manage.py(其它文件內容與flask-sqlalchemy中一樣)
from s8day130_pro import create_app,db from flask_script import Manager from flask_migrate import Migrate,MigrateCommandapp = create_app() manager = Manager(app)Migrate(app, db) """ # 數據庫遷移命名python manage.py db initpython manage.py db migrate # makemigrationspython manage.py db upgrade # migrate """ manager.add_command('db', MigrateCommand)if __name__ == '__main__':# app.run()manager.run()首先執行python manage.py db init會生成如下文件
然后就可以利用python manage.py db migrate和python manage.py db upgrade命令進行數據遷移了
轉載于:https://www.cnblogs.com/xyhh/p/10860413.html
與50位技術專家面對面20年技術見證,附贈技術全景圖總結
以上是生活随笔為你收集整理的flask-migrate数据迁移的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 字符串操作方法
- 下一篇: linux下用iptables做本机端口